I have/test Hardy since the 4. Alpha. 
If i plug in a USB Device after i wake the Laptop from Suspend (In my case a 
MyBook-Harddrive) kded uses all resources (top shows 95%CPU only caused by 
kded). 
It also happens when i just remove the USB-Harddisc and replugin it.
So i'm not able to use USB Drives twice in one session. 
I can only stop kded when i reboot the hole system.

Hardware: Thinkpad T43p
